As we countdown to the most auspicious time on the Chinese calendar - Chinese New Year, you will see all things red and gold streaming from the shops from decorations, to flowers to outfits. Both being lucky colours to bring in good fortune for the New Year!


Heading into Chinatown or if you are based in Asia ( Singapore / Hong Kong/ Malaysia) you will see lined along the streets and outside most homes and businesses, tons of decorations with fishes ( as the word for fish -"yu" sounds similar to that of the meaning of abundance), chinese characters of luck and spring, rooster and chickens ( this year in particular as 2017 is the Year of the Rooster) and gold ingots.
